Things that dogs are most afraid of and will die if they touch them:

Food poisoning:

1. Grapes

< p>Although no one knows why grapes are poisonous to dogs, they are poisonous to dogs, and one of the most serious complications after eating them is kidney failure.

For some dogs, one or two raisins can kill them, so owners must not give grapes to their dogs!

2. Chocolate

Chocolate is processed from cocoa beans and contains a variety of methylxanthine derivatives, including caffeine and theobromine. Chocolate It contains theobromine, which will act on the central nervous system and heart muscle of puppies, causing them to die.

3. Onions

Onions are also a dangerous food for dogs, because eating too many onions can cause anemia and other problems, and over time can also lead to the death of dogs. .

Diseases:

1. Obesity

Obesity is a health killer for all living things, and it is also a great threat to the health of dogs. Once a dog becomes excessively obese, the joints and lumbar spine will be greatly burdened, and there will also be associated diseases such as high blood pressure, hyperlipidemia, and cardiovascular and cerebrovascular diseases. Please pet owners do a good job in dog weight management. Prevent dogs from dying prematurely and shortening their lifespan due to obesity.

2. Parvovirus

Parvovirus is the most common malignant infectious disease in dogs, and its mortality rate is also very high. Small preventive measures are to protect the cleanliness of the dog's stomach and food, and prevent the dog from picking up unclean food outdoors or coming into contact with the feces of stray or sick dogs.

4. Kidney disease

The death of dogs due to kidney disease is also related to food. Dogs who eat too much salt for a long time can easily lead to kidney failure, kidney damage and early death. Some dogs also died of kidney failure after eating commercial dog food that was too cheap, had substandard production quality, and contained various additives.

2. Poisoning

The date of death of a dog after poisoning cannot be determined. Whether or not the dog dies and the speed of death are determined by the concentration and toxicity of the poison. If the concentration is high and strong, Toxic, the dog may die within ten minutes, otherwise it may die after a few days. The clinical manifestations after poisoning include foaming at the mouth, irregular heartbeat, white conjunctiva, purple tongue, and difficulty breathing.
